The prayer in the present Civil Writ Petition filed under Article 226/227 of the Constitution of India, is for issuance of a writ in the nature of mandamus directing the respondents to fill vacant posts of Veterinary Inspectors pursuant to Advertisement No.14/2021 dated 07.07.2021. 2.

Learned counsel would submit that in the advertisement No.14/2021 dated 07.07.2021 (Annexure P1), the petitioner being aspirant had applied and his name figured at Sr. No.715 in the combined merit list dated 01.10.2021 (Annexure P2) and the candidates till Sr. No.709 were selected and appointed whereas 7 more posts are still lying vacant but petitioner is not being considered even though he has obtained his essential qualification from recognized institution and not from RMIT and Guru Kashi, Universities. In this regard, a legal notice dated 19.09.2023 (Annexure P7), has been served upon the respondents, which has yet not evoked any response. He thus, at this stage, on instructions, submits that the petitioner is sanguine of it being considered in a positive manner, in case, a direction is given to the respondents to decide the same in a time bound manner by granting him an opportunity of hearing. 3.

At the asking of the Court, Mr. Charanpreet Singh, AAG, Punjab, accepts notice on behalf of the respondent-State and has no objection to the limited prayer made.

5.

In view of the aforesaid and without commenting upon the merits of the case, this petition is hereby disposed of with a direction to the respondents to decide the legal notice dated 19.09.2023, Annexure P7 by taking into account the pleas of the petitioner raised therein, within a period of 3 months and if found entitled, necessary benefit be granted to him forthwith. 04.04.2024 ( AMAN CHAUDHARY ) ashok JUDGE Whether speaking/reasoned : Yes/No Whether reportable :
